Minutes for SCR1608 - Committee on Judiciary

Short Title

Proposing to amend section 3 of the Kansas bill of rights regarding the right to petition the government for the redress of grievances, including by citizen-initiated grand jury.

Minutes Content for Fri, Mar 12, 2021

Jason Thompson gave a bill brief on SCR1608 stating it would amend Section 3 of the Bill of Rights of the Constitution of the State of Kansas relating to the right to petition the government for the redress of grievances, including by citizen-initiated grand jury. (Attachment 1)

There were questions for the Revisor.

Philip Cosby spoke in support of SCR1608 stating that a citizen generated grand jury is the oldest and closest to the original intent of the 5th Amendment of the US Constitution. It provides for citizens to call a grand jury to investigate criminal activity involving government or a perceived failure of the prosecutor or system to charge or investigate a particular person or entity. It is a remedy for judicial reform. Kansas is not inventing the citizen-initiated grand jury process; Kansas is leading in reinstating a usurped and almost forgotten historical constitutional right.  (Attachment 2) (Attachment 3) (Attachment 4) (Attachment 5) (Attachment 6) (Attachment 7)

There was neither Neutral nor Opponent testimony.

There was discussion.

The hearing was closed.
